WebIn mathematics, the free group F S over a given set S consists of all words that can be built from members of S, considering two words to be different unless their equality follows from the group axioms (e.g. st = suu −1 t, but s ≠ t −1 for s,t,u ∈ S).The members of S are called generators of F S, and the number of generators is the rank of the free group. . WebGenerator (category theory) In mathematics, specifically category theory, a family of generators (or family of separators) of a category is a collection () of objects in , such that for any two distinct morphisms,: in , that is with , there is some in and some morphism : such that . If the collection consists of a single object , we say it is a generator (or separator).
